Examine the relationship between Reward and Motivation in the Psychological Context.
An 'incentive' or 'reward' can be anything that attracts a workers attention and stimulates him to work. In the words of Burrack and Smith, "An incentive scheme is a plan or program to motivate individual with monetary rewards (incentive pay or monetary bonus), but may also include a variety of non-monetary rewards or prizes."
(Mamoria C., Personnel Management, 3rd ed., Himalaya Publishing House, Mumbai, 1984)
